1. Weiterleitung zu NetzLiving.de
  2. Forum
    1. Unerledigte Themen
  3. zum neuen Forum
  • Anmelden
  • Suche
Dieses Thema
  • Alles
  • Dieses Thema
  • Dieses Forum
  • Seiten
  • Forum
  • Erweiterte Suche
  1. Informatik Forum
  2. Software und Anwendungen
  3. Betriebssysteme

Safari zeigt Bilder nicht an

    • MacOS
  • davewood
  • 31. Juli 2010 um 15:22
  • Unerledigt
Hallo zusammen,

das Informatik-Forum geht in den Archivmodus, genaue Informationen kann man der entsprechenden Ankündigung entnehmen. Als Dankeschön für die Treue bekommt man von uns einen Gutscheincode (informatikforum30) womit man bei netzliving.de 30% auf das erste Jahr sparen kann. (Genaue Infos sind ebenfalls in der Ankündigung)

Vielen Dank für die Treue und das Verständnis!
  • davewood
    Punkte
    3.204
    Beiträge
    536
    • 31. Juli 2010 um 15:22
    • #1

    Kann mir jemand sagen wieso Safari diese Seite nicht korrekt anzeigt. FF und IE aber schon.

    http://sos-kinderdorf.at

    Einmal editiert, zuletzt von davewood (31. Juli 2010 um 20:41) aus folgendem Grund: solved, url geändert

  • Paulchen
    Gast
    • 31. Juli 2010 um 16:09
    • #2
    Zitat von davewood

    Kann mir jemand sagen wieso Safari diese Seite nicht korrekt anzeigt.

    Das Bild http://philippschweiger.davidschmidt.at/media/1/send hat laut Antwort des Webservers eine Content-Length von 3.

  • davewood
    Punkte
    3.204
    Beiträge
    536
    • 31. Juli 2010 um 16:18
    • #3

    Hmm versteh ich nicht wirklich wieso die content-length falsch ist. Der Request sollt ja derselbe sein.

    hier mein FF firebug response header für http://philippschweiger.davidschmidt.at/media/1/send

    Code
    Response Headersview source
    Date	Sat, 31 Jul 2010 14:10:11 GMT
    Server	Apache/2.2.11 (Ubuntu) DAV/2 SVN/1.5.4 mod_fastcgi/2.4.6 PHP/5.2.6-3ubuntu4.5 with Suhosin-Patch mod_python/3.3.1 Python/2.6.2
    Content-Length	21353
    Content-Disposition	inline; filename=foo.jpg
    Last-Modified	Mon, 26 Jul 2010 21:44:03 GMT
    Etag	"10601e-5369-48c5148796ec0"
    Content-Type	image/jpeg

    Request:

    Code
    Request Headersview source
    Host	philippschweiger.davidschmidt.at
    User-Agent	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.9.2.3) Gecko/20100423 Ubuntu/10.04 (lucid) Firefox/3.6.3
    Accept	text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
    Accept-Language	en-us,en;q=0.5
    Accept-Encoding	gzip,deflate
    Accept-Charset	ISO-8859-1,utf-8;q=0.7,*;q=0.7
    Keep-Alive	115
    Connection	keep-alive
    Referer	http://philippschweiger.davidschmidt.at/media/1/show
    If-Modified-Since	Mon, 26 Jul 2010 21:44:03 GMT
    If-None-Match	"10601e-5369-48c5148796ec0"
    Cache-Control	max-age=0
    Alles anzeigen

    ps:
    FYI: Ich liefere Bilder mit mod_xsendfile aus.

  • davewood
    Punkte
    3.204
    Beiträge
    536
    • 31. Juli 2010 um 16:30
    • #4

    Solution:

    A hack to get mod_xsendfile to work in Catalyst (Perl MVC Framework) is to set the body to "foo" to avoid certain postprocessing.

    foo ... size 3

    FF and IE apparently can cope with fucked up content sizes better than safari.
    Now that I set the content-length myself everything should be fine. I just have to wait for the browsershots queue to get me the safari screenshot.

    Opsa, alle sin englisch hehe

    Danke Paulchen

  • Maximilian Rupp 27. Dezember 2024 um 00:09

    Hat das Thema aus dem Forum Betriebssysteme nach Betriebssysteme verschoben.

  1. Datenschutzerklärung
  2. Impressum